Recently I realized I am not hearing my notification sounds. The icons are popping up but no sound. I realized it's because when I turn my ringtone volume off the notification volume goes off also so they are not 2 separate volumes any more and I thought they used be? Can someone clarify this for me please. Mary

Unless the manufacturer changes the code and separates them again, the ringtone volume for calls and the volume for notifications tones were merged in either Android ICS or KitKat versions of the OS. The G4 should be running either Lollipop or Marshmallow.
